As described the car is a 2005 (05) GT Silverstone with black leather. Its done just over 10,000 miles and includes the hardtop, stand, storage cover and tonneau cover. I bought the car off the forum user Docdolittle in February. It was registered by Penine (North Wales) in March 2005. Serviced at 5,500 miles and taxed until Feb 07.

Its in excellent condition, just the odd stone chip on the bonnet and a couple of tiny scratches which have polished out. Rear tyres are 3/4mm, fronts not much wear. No rattles from the hard or softtop. Its done an Andy Walsh driver training day (essential in my opinion) but no trackdays.
